Output c68170b7d7cbb68c2c2c5953119bb38c4cf3377e0cfd26bd05407a4b2d7f3dea:4

value
21570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ad5dc9a574401e404cadfe1a1002426449717d8 OP_EQUAL
address
3BRukFXaLpJX4Vq8s6bAUSRbBCyJkk5b8o
transaction
c68170b7d7cbb68c2c2c5953119bb38c4cf3377e0cfd26bd05407a4b2d7f3dea
confirmations
481658
spent
true